PROTON CONDUCTING POLYMER MEMBRANE CONTAINING PROTON CONDUCTING POLYMER SYNTHESIZED WITH DIFFERENT ALCOHOL MONOMER, MODIFICATION METHODS THEREOF, MEMBRANE-ELECTROLYTE ASSEMBLIES USING THE SAME AND FUEL CELL HAVING THEM

PURPOSE: A polymer electrolyte membrane is provided to ensure excellent hydrogen ion conductivity, to improve water absorption, methanol permeation, and performance of a membrane-electrode assembly. CONSTITUTION: A polymer electrolyte membrane includes a proton conducting copolymer represented by chemical formula 1. The hydrogen ion conductivity of the polymer electrolyte membrane is 0.100 S/cm or more and the thickness is 40-80 micron. A method for improving physical properties of the polymer electrolyte membrane comprises the steps of: preparing hydrogen ion conductive copolymers represented by chemical formula 1; casting the solution in which the hydrogen ion conductive copolymers are dissolved in an organic solvent; and evaporating and drying the organic solvent.
